Waikiki Wall jetty with gazebo

It's wonderful to walk along the oceanfront watching the waves crash against the boardwalk, in a parklike setting also called San Souci State Recreational Park.
A jetty with a gazebo on the end, in the heart of Waikiki Beach. A popular bodyboarding and snorkeling spot where the reef is inches from your knees!
